> This is my first posting to your list, and I apologize for posting
> if this issue has been discussed already. I maintain three hives
> "just for fun" but in the last year received my education regarding
> varroa (and perhaps tracheal mites, but I can't tell). This year
> I've put some crisco patties in my hives and attempted to purchase some
> menthol. Alas the only amounts that I can purchase appear to be for
> 25 hives- much more than I think I could use. Is there any source
> for smaller amounts, say something like 9 ounces for so?
 
I had an old time beekeeper suggest ordinary menthol cough drops.  (He
suggested Luden's).  Read the label and look for ones that don't contain
things possibly harmful to bees (that is they're pretty much limited to
menthol, and sugar/corn syrup/honey, and color/flavoring.
 
I think he suggested 3 boxes per hive.
